NetLogo es un entorno de modelado programable de múltiples agentes diseñado para simular fenómenos naturales y sociales. Desarrollado por Uri Wilensky en 1999, ha sido continuamente mejorado en el Centro para el Aprendizaje Conectado y el Modelado Basado en Computadora. NetLogo es particularmente hábil en modelar sistemas complejos que evolucionan con el tiempo, permitiendo a los usuarios instruir a numerosos "agentes" independientes que operan simultáneamente. Esta capacidad permite explorar la relación entre los comportamientos individuales y los patrones emergentes resultantes de sus interacciones.
Características y Funcionalidad Clave:
- Compatibilidad Multiplataforma: Funciona sin problemas en sistemas Mac, Windows y Linux.
- Lenguaje Totalmente Programable: Utiliza un dialecto extendido de Logo para apoyar el modelado basado en agentes.
- Modelado Basado en Agentes: Facilita la creación y control de agentes móviles (tortugas) que interactúan sobre una cuadrícula de agentes estacionarios (parches), con la capacidad de formar redes y agregados a través de agentes de enlace.
- Biblioteca de Modelos Extensa: Ofrece una colección completa de simulaciones preescritas en diversas disciplinas, incluyendo biología, física, química, matemáticas, ciencias de la computación, economía y psicología social.
- Entorno Interactivo: Presenta un constructor de interfaces con herramientas como botones, deslizadores, interruptores y monitores, junto con un centro de comandos para la interacción en tiempo real.
- Herramientas de Visualización: Proporciona opciones de visualización en 2D y 3D, formas vectoriales escalables y sistemas de gráficos dinámicos para la representación de datos.
- Simulaciones Participativas con HubNet: Permite simulaciones participativas en red donde cada participante puede controlar un agente, mejorando las experiencias de aprendizaje colaborativo.
Valor Principal y Soluciones para el Usuario:
NetLogo sirve como una plataforma versátil para educadores, estudiantes e investigadores para construir y analizar simulaciones de sistemas complejos. Su interfaz fácil de usar y su extensa documentación lo hacen accesible para principiantes, mientras que sus robustas capacidades de programación satisfacen las necesidades de investigación avanzada. Al cerrar la brecha entre los comportamientos individuales y los fenómenos colectivos, NetLogo ayuda a los usuarios a comprender y predecir la dinámica de varios sistemas, facilitando así la toma de decisiones informadas y proporcionando una comprensión más profunda de los procesos complejos.